Proceeds from the Charity Ball will be used to fund
community programs and agencies focused on child and family enrichment,
including health and wellness and elderly volunteerism. In the past, the
event's revenues have been used to begin and fund community agencies such
as Gulf Bend Center, The Youth Home of Victoria, the Child Welfare Agency,
Hope School, Making the Grade and the Women's Crisis Center.
